He’s not particularly quick over 50 yards but his acceleration over a short distance is exceptional and can leave any fullback for dead. He’s got attributes you can’t teach and weaknesses that can definitely be improved upon.

Not having he can’t be comfortable on the right either. As against Villa in one of his very few starts there he was very good. I’m hoping Pep revisits that soon as that Villa game was as well balanced as we’ve looked in a good while with Grealish keeping the width and the ball on the left and Doku able to give us genuine width by going on the outside and able to pick someone out for his assist by being on his strong foot to play the cross in for Rodri. It certainly created much more space for Foden to do his thing in the middle. Agree his first touch could be improved and lately it has been better.
